    This place is SOLID - excellent for brunch. The namesake Churro Waffle is a MUST on your visit. This is a belated review of a visit at noon on a Saturday in late April: Located in a small shopping plaza, it's not much on the outside, but - big pro for me - boasts a parking lot. Inside is a family-friendly more modern diner-esque (but slightly more crowded) vibe. There was a bit of a wait for a table for 4 on Saturday - nothing too long though. And yes, the wait was well worth it. I'm a savory brunch lover - so much so I usually forgo the sweets which can be too much for me, unless it's a well-done combo. The Bacon Waffle (substituted in Churro Waffle) with the Sea Salt Caramel Ice Cream on the side (so it wouldn't get soggy and I could control the ratio) was a PEFRECT BLEND OF SAVORY AND SWEET and will definitely have me coming back when I'm next in the area. Besides my beloved Bacon Waffle, we ordered the Chicken Churro Waffle, Steak Fajita Bowl, Eggs Benedict, Lox Benedict, Carnitas Benedict, and Hibiscus Lemonade (sweet and refreshing), and a Horchata Iced Coffee (very good)! Everything was delicious (only complaint was the friend who ordered Carnitas Benedict said it was a bit overpowering a flavor for the egg / hollandaise) - and the service was quick, kind, and able to easily accommodate requests and substitutions. Definitely a rock-solid brunch choice - highly recommend!
